This was at GM in Wentzville, it feels like high school all over again, a bunch of grown adults gossiping amongst themselves about others, supervisors talking about how bad their bosses are in front of all the other employees, employees and bosses talking about how bad the company itself is, toxic work environment, they can and will force you to work extra hours(4 hours before your scheduled shift, and 4 hours extra on your shift you are on, so dont make plans, or have family stuff you have to attend, I was forced multiple times within a week because the employees there dont like to show up for work. The training here is trash, they train you on multiple post in one week, they expect you to retain all the information they shove down your throat after doing the post for one day with a trainer, the recruiters are extremely vague with compensation such as benefits, they dont tell you that you can be forced when they hire you, and they will probably hire you on the spot and have you take a drug test on the spot, which is nothing but a mouth swab, they seem like they just want robots and bodies, their HR team is full of heartless corporate types that dont care or value employees as people, I felt like nothing to management, the people there will smile in your face and then stab you in the back the moment they have a chance, it felt like multiple employees missed the sexual harrassment section of the training, because I heard multiple comments there that were MAJOR hostile work environment/toxic/sexual innuendos that have no place in the work place. this company is based out of California, and it shows within their training. My advice would be to stay far far far away from this company if you are approached by a recruiter.
